On 06/24/2013 04:27 PM, David Herrmann wrote:
The current situation regarding boot-framebuffers (VGA, VESA/VBE, EFI) on
x86 causes troubles when loading multiple fbdev drivers. The global
"struct screen_info" does not provide any state-tracking about which
drivers use the FBs. request_mem_region() theoretically works, but
unfortunately vesafb/efifb ignore it due to quirks for broken boards.

Avoid this by creating a "platform-framebuffer" device with a pointer
to the "struct screen_info" as platform-data. Drivers can now create
platform-drivers and the driver-core will refuse multiple drivers being
active simultaneously.

We keep the screen_info available for backwards-compatibility. Drivers
can be converted in follow-up patches.

Apart from "platform-framebuffer" devices, this also introduces a
compatibility option for "simple-framebuffer" drivers which recently got
introduced for OF based systems. If CONFIG_X86_SYSFB is selected, we
try to match the screen_info against a simple-framebuffer supported
format. If we succeed, we create a "simple-framebuffer" device instead
of a platform-framebuffer.
This allows to reuse the simplefb.c driver across architectures and also
to introduce a SimpleDRM driver. There is no need to have vesafb.c,
efifb.c, simplefb.c and more just to have architecture specific quirks
in their setup-routines.

Instead, we now move the architecture specific quirks into x86-setup and
provide a generic simple-framebuffer. For backwards-compatibility (if
strange formats are used), we still allow vesafb/efifb to be loaded
simultaneously and pick up all remaining devices.
quoted hunk ↗ jump to hunk
diff --git a/arch/x86/Kconfig b/arch/x86/Kconfig
+config X86_SYSFB
+	bool "Mark VGA/VBE/EFI FB as generic system framebuffer"
+	help
+	  Firmwares often provide initial graphics framebuffers so the BIOS,
+	  bootloader or kernel can show basic video-output during boot for
+	  user-guidance and debugging. Historically, x86 used the VESA BIOS
+	  Extensions and EFI-framebuffers for this, which are mostly limited
+	  to x86. However, a generic system-framebuffer initialization emerged
+	  recently on some non-x86 architectures.
After this patch has been in the kernel a while, that very last won't
really be true; simplefb won't have been introduced recently. Perhaps
just delete that one sentence?
+	  This option, if enabled, marks VGA/VBE/EFI framebuffers as generic
+	  framebuffers so the new generic system-framebuffer drivers can be
+	  used on x86.
+
+	  This breaks any x86-only driver like efifb, vesafb, uvesafb, which
+	  will not work if this is selected.
Doesn't that imply that some form of conflicts or depends ! statement
should be added here?
quoted hunk ↗ jump to hunk
diff --git a/arch/x86/kernel/Makefile b/arch/x86/kernel/Makefile
+obj-y					+= sysfb.o
I suspect that should be obj-$(CONFIG_X86_SYSFB) += sysfb.o.
quoted hunk ↗ jump to hunk
diff --git a/arch/x86/kernel/sysfb.c b/arch/x86/kernel/sysfb.c
+#ifdef CONFIG_X86_SYSFB
Rather than ifdef'ing the body of this file, why not create a dummy
static inline version of add_sysfb() and put that into a header file
that users include. There should be a header file to prototype the
function anyway. That way, you avoid all of the ifdefs and static inline
functions in this file.
+static bool parse_mode(const struct screen_info *si,
+		       struct simplefb_platform_data *mode)
+			strlcpy(mode->format, f->name, sizeof(mode->format));
Per my comments about the type of mode->format, I think that could just be:

mode->format = f->name;

... since formats[] (i.e. f) isn't initdata.
+#else /* CONFIG_X86_SYSFB */
+
+static bool parse_mode(const struct screen_info *si,
+		       struct simplefb_platform_data *mode)
+{
+	return false;
+}
+
+static int create_simplefb(const struct screen_info *si,
+			   const struct simplefb_platform_data *mode)
+{
+	return -EINVAL;
+}
+
+#endif /* CONFIG_X86_SYSFB */
Following on from my ifdef comment above, I believe those versions of
those functions will always cause add_sysfb() to return -ENODEV, so you
may as well provide a static inline for add_sysfb() instead.
